From Guesswork to Predictability

Marketing has long relied on testing, iteration, and instinct. AI is changing that.

With predictive analytics, brands are no longer reacting to user behavior — they are anticipating it. Campaigns are being optimized in real time, budgets are allocated dynamically, and decisions are driven by patterns invisible to the human eye.

The result? Less waste. More impact.

Content at Scale - Without Losing Relevance

AI is making it possible to generate content faster than ever before. But the real shift isn’t speed — it’s personalization at scale.

Instead of one message for everyone, brands can now create multiple variations tailored to different audiences, behaviors, and preferences.

The future isn’t about more content.
It’s about the right content, for the right person, at the right moment.

Ad platforms are becoming increasingly autonomous.

AI is already:

  • Optimizing bids in real time

  • Testing multiple creatives simultaneously

  • Identifying high-converting audiences faster than manual targeting

In the future, marketers will spend less time managing campaigns — and more time defining strategy.
